Subject: [PATCH v2 00/10] staging: exfat: Clean up return codes, revisited
Date: Sun, 3 Nov 2019 20:44:56 -0500 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20191104014510.102356-1-Valdis.Kletnieks@vt.edu> (raw)
The rest of the conversion from internal error numbers to the
standard values used in the rest of the kernel.
Patch 10/10 is logically separate, merging multiple #defines
into one place in errno.h. It's included in the series because
it depends on patch 1/10.
Valdis Kletnieks (10):
staging: exfat: Clean up return codes - FFS_FORMATERR
staging: exfat: Clean up return codes - FFS_MEDIAERR
staging: exfat: Clean up return codes - FFS_EOF
staging: exfat: Clean up return codes - FFS_INVALIDFID
staging: exfat: Clean up return codes - FFS_ERROR
staging: exfat: Clean up return codes - remove unused codes
staging: exfat: Clean up return codes - FFS_SUCCESS
staging: exfat: Collapse redundant return code translations
staging: exfat: Correct return code
errno.h: Provide EFSCORRUPTED for everybody
